34 minutes ago, Poimagic said:

Anyways, how will Clive fair in the current meta and do you think he will be good in horse emblem? From what I can tell, he is like he is in the games. An armored unit on a horse.

He is near the bottom of the meta, or about average if he is in a pony team. He is not very useful for most players, especially if they have Xander and Camus. Clive does not attack from a distance nor does he have Distant Counter in his weapon. He is not an armored unit on a horse either; most armored units have 35+ neutral Defense. Like Mathilda and Clair, he is another disappointment.

If a player does not have Camus in their Barracks, Abel, Roderick, and Peri are all better options than Clive.

There are currently 10 playable red mages, 11 blue, and 10 green. So red isn't short on mages any more than the other colors, although it's more concentrated on infantry than the others: non-infantry mages of each color are 1 for red (just Leo), 4 for blue, and 2 for green.

It's also worth bearing in mind that blue and green, which started out behind red (6 red, 3 blue, and 3 green in the initial hero lineup) have caught up in part due to getting more seasonal characters. Ignoring seasonal characters puts the counts at 9 red, 8 blue, and 8 green, so by that metric red is still in the lead.

There are some infantry villains that would be cool to add as red mages like Lyon, Arvis, and Julius, but it does get a bit tougher to find non-infantry red mages. Aversa is one I've been hoping for since she could be the first red tome flier, as well as finally being a non-seasonal tome flier. And yeah, Azelle and Miranda could be cool as mounted red mages if they go with their promoted versions, although Heroes has so far seemed to tend towards unpromoted versions of characters. (For example, Eirika, Ephraim, Seliph, Lachesis, and Leon are all unmounted, although Eliwood is mounted.) And of course Old Arvis as an armored red mage would be awesome, but I'm hesitant to keep hoping too much for that until we at least get regular Arvis first.

I'm sure we'll get armored mages eventually, but I think it's fairly likely that like with flying mages, they'll be first introduced as seasonal characters. Mage fliers seem to have been working as a way to draw a lot of attention to limited-time banners: they certainly have been for me.
